We are currently working with an elegant 4* Hotel in Northampton. The company offers unique views, facilities out of this world and much more!
As a Junior Pastry Chef, you’ll be supporting the Sous Chef and Head Chef in producing consistent high-quality pastry as well as ensuring the kitchen’s Health, Safety and hygiene are maintained to high standards.
Roles and Responsibilities:
- Day to day running of the Pastry section with another 2 pastry chef de parties.
- Ensuring the highest standard of hygiene & cleanliness to ensure safe food preparation.
- Providing a safe and secure environment by adhering to the company Health & Safety and Food Safety policies ensuring all areas are compliant with audit requirements.
- Delivery of exceptional food standards as outlined in the department handbooks.
- Preparing ingredients, cooking meals and plating dishes on hotel menus as required throughout your shift according to customer requirements.
- Assisting the Sous Chef and Head Chef in keeping the kitchen, stores and ancillary departments running smoothly during service.
Level 2 Food Safety Certificate essential with Level 3 preferred. Experience in 2 rosette kitchen.

How to prepare for a job interview at CFCHOSPITALITYRECRUITMENT
✨Know Your Pastry Basics
Brush up on your pastry techniques and terminology before the interview. Be ready to discuss your favourite recipes and how you approach creating them. This shows your passion and knowledge, which is key for a Junior Pastry Sous Chef.
✨Showcase Your Hygiene Knowledge
Since health and safety are crucial in the kitchen, be prepared to talk about your understanding of hygiene standards. Mention any relevant certifications, like your Level 2 Food Safety Certificate, and share examples of how you've maintained cleanliness in previous roles.
✨Demonstrate Team Spirit
This role involves working closely with other chefs, so highlight your teamwork skills. Share experiences where you collaborated effectively in a kitchen environment, and how you supported your colleagues during busy service times.
✨Ask Insightful Questions
Prepare some thoughtful questions about the hotel's pastry section and its operations. This not only shows your interest in the role but also gives you a chance to learn more about the team dynamics and expectations, helping you assess if it’s the right fit for you.
